Job Duties: Barnardo's is the lead body for the co-ordination of the Outer South and East Belfast Family Support HubFamily Support Hubs function across the NI region to offer family support to families at the earliest stage. Each Family Support Hub is a group of organisations including community, voluntary and statutory services that work with children and young people.Outer South and East Belfast Family Support Hub links children aged 0-18 years to early intervention family support services to improve outcomes for children and young people.The Family Support Hub Co-ordinator will respond to families requesting a service, listen to their needs and, with the support of Hub members, access services that best suits the family requirements. This post involves speaking with families, identifying appropriate services, linking with Hub member organisations. You will be responsible for the administration of processing these service requests.
